    Hi there - any chance you could expand on what has changed/improved for you?

    I haven't noticed any changes and for me the MFA process with Quicken is extremely painful (multiple accounts each with multiple phone numbers). For every sync I have to wait for the account to be queried, select the correct phone number, wait for the code by text, paste it in, wait for the account to sync and the next account to be queried, select the phone number, paste the code in, and so on...

    As a result I tend to avoid using Quicken as much I should, just because syncing is so painful. I could also envision some fairly straightforward ways to make it much less painful for me, e.g.
    1. Let me set the default phone number. It's the right one 99+% of the time as the other(s) are just for backup.
    2. Let me continue using the app while the querying process happens unobtrusively in the background.
    3. Wait until all the MFA codes have been requested, then present me with a screen that contains a field for all of the security codes and let me paste them all in at once (instead of one at a time).

    I wonder if there's already a feature request for something along these lines? I did a quick search but did not see one.

    They are working fine for me. I do notice that if I don't have a transaction actively selected (ie, dark blue) they do come up blank. This happens, for example, if a transaction is selected in a register but then you click on the register name in the sidebar (which turns the selected transaction from dark blue to gray). Could this be what you're seeing?
